Where to find forest functional level




















To raise the functional level of a forest, you must be a member of the Enterprise Admins group. The Active Directory Domains and Trusts snap-in is also used to raise the functional level of the forest.

Right click on the root of the snap-in, and select Raise Forest Functional Level. In the next windows, select the required functional forest level, and click the Raise button.
